Enduringly fascinating enigmas of the bird world, owls have long drawn the attention of humans as we try to understand them—varied species with distinctly expressive faces and striking, elusive, powerful characters. Observing owls in the care of local rescue organizations, San Francisco Bay Area resident Jeannine Chappell begins her collage-like works on paper, later digitally enhancing them. Her work conveys the unique character of each species, bringing us closer to these intensely wild birds.
